President Mahama’s X account hacked

March 18, 2025 10:18 am
Facebook
WhatsApp
Twitter
Telegram
Email
Pinterest
Print
    President John Dramani Mahama

    President John Dramani Mahama’s official X account (@JDMahama) has been hacked.

    The Minister of State for Government Communications, Felix Kwakye Ofosu, confirmed this in an interview on Accra-based GHOne TV.

    This comes after the account was used to promote a cryptocurrency scam linked to Solanafrica, sparking mixed reactions.

    The fraudulent post claimed the project was “led by Ghana’s President  John Mahama to make payments across Africa free using the Solana blockchain.”

    The token has since been rug-pulled, leaving investors with losses.

    However, Abura Asebu Kwamankese MP Felix Kwakye Ofosu has assured that efforts are underway to recover the account and urged Ghanaians to disregard any suspicious posts from the handle.

    “Well, there’s been a hack. Some unscrupulous persons have compromised it, but efforts are underway to recover it, and it should be recovered any moment from now,” he stated
